From the Wall Street Journal, Finally, the Nets Have Reason to Smile: Williams's Nets Lack Howard But Look Legit:

"In my seven years here, I've never seen a surge like this," [Brooklyn Nets CEO Brett] Yormark said. "Obviously, I've been very bullish on Brooklyn and have never wavered—new building, having a team that Brooklynites can root for. And that's all great. But at the end of the day, you need to have a product."

Which is why Borough President Marty Markowitz is turning over Borough Hall today to a press conference and rally. Brooklyn finally has "a product," a "sports entertainment corporation" to call its own.
